However, to start off you really only need a good rod, reel, license, and some bait, all of … Web7 Things Every Fisherman Needs to Get Started Fly Fishing Fly Rod You can’t fish without a rod. Beginners should opt for a moderate rod in both length and weight. 5 to 7 weight and 8 to 10 feet are ideal sizes for rookie anglers and work for a variety of fly fishing species. Many anglers who are new to saltwater fishing underestimate the importance of knowing when the tides are moving. Asking the local tackle shops about where to fish during the tidal movements can ensure that you have the best chances of catching fish at the best times of the day. WebApr 13, 2016 · 2. Try Some Fun Contests. Bring along a chalkboard and keep track of every fish caught. Let the children know that there will be a prize for the one who brings in the most fish. You may also want to have prizes for things like the biggest and smallest fish caught and best sportsmanship. At the end of the day, each child should win something.
